Electric motor torque limiting clutch

An electric motor includes a housing and a stator mounted to the housing. A rotor is rotatably supported relative to the stator and a drive shaft is connected to the rotor by a torque limiting clutch disposed within the housing. The electric motor with a torque limiting clutch eliminates high torque episodes due to slippery driving conditions. Also, a torque limiting clutch that features a ball-ramp device with two ramp angles performs the function of a two stage torsional vibration damper. An electric motor can have a specific torque signature that can excite certain vibration modes inside the transmission that can create noise, vibration and harshness (NVH) and durability concerns.

Slip clutch device for an electric driving machine

A slip clutch device for an electric driving machine includes a rotation axis, an input side rotatable about the rotation axis, an output side rotatable about the rotation axis, and a slip clutch connecting the input side to the output side in a torque-limiting manner. The slip clutch includes an electrical insulation element for preventing an electrical disruptive discharge line between the input side and the output side, a friction disc, and a friction plate, pressed against the friction disc in a contact region in a frictionally engaged torque-transmitting manner. The friction disc or the friction plate is formed from an electrically insulating material in an insulation region extending radially over the contact region, and the insulation region is a bearing structure for radially transmitting torque.

Two stage torque limiter

A torque limiting tool comprises a two stage torque limiting mechanism that resides within a housing. The torque limiting mechanism comprises a shank positioned through a gear, a plate, and a bias member. The plate is constructed having at least one post and at least one tooth providing a ramp surface that extends outwardly from a plate surface. The gear is constructed having at least one recess providing at least one inclined surface that resides part-way within the thickness of the gear. The gear and plate are positioned in opposition so that the at least one tooth and extending post are received within or detachably mated to the opposing recess and through-bore. Torque is transferred therebetween the plate and gear when the ramped teeth and extending posts mate with the respective recess and through-bore. A first torque limit is exceeded when the post breaks free from the through-bore. A second, lesser torque limit is exceeded when the ramped teeth release from their mated recess.

Dual wheel swivel caster with a torque limiter and associated method

A dual wheel swivel caster includes a swivel assembly, a horn, a rig hub, a solid axle, at least one ring of roller bearings, first and second wheel assemblies, and at least one ring of bearings. The first wheel assembly has a first wheel axis, and includes an annular plate element. The torque limiter is configured to rotatably couple the first and second wheel assemblies with the solid axle when the torque between the annular plate element and the torque limiter is below a preset value. The torque limiter is configured to rotatably decouple the first wheel assembly from the solid axle and the second wheel assembly when the torque exceeds the preset value. The ring of bearings is configured to allow the first wheel assembly to rotate independently of the solid axle and the second wheel assembly about the rotational axis when the torque exceeds the preset value.
